Principal Procurement Specialist Salary in Connecticut

How much does a Principal Procurement Specialist make in Connecticut?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Principal Procurement Specialist in Connecticut is $50,721 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$24.

However, a Principal Procurement Specialist's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$59,131
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$45,932 to $55,123
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$41,572

Principal Procurement Specialist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Principal Procurement Specialist ro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 45%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Pharmaceuticals and Edu., Gov't. & Nonprofit s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 25% above the average. In contrast, Principal Procurement Specialist positions in Retail & Wholesale or Energy & Utilities typ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Principal Procurement Specialist as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
